Ride Your Way to Health: Six Ways Cycling Improves Body and Mind

Apart from a leisurely means of transportation, cycling is among the best exercises for enhancing your mental and physical condition.

This low-impact activity has several health advantages whether your riding on a stationary bike or pedalling around picturesque paths. Expert trainers have listed the six main benefits of riding.

1. Cardiac Condition “Cycling is a great approach to improve heart health,” fitness instructor Sarah Mitchell notes. “It gets your blood pumping and tones your cardiovascular system.”

2. increases joint movement. Cycling is low-impact, hence it’s easy on the joints even if it helps to increase their range of motion. Those with hip or knee problems who want a milder workout will find it ideal.

3. improves mental health Cycling has been demonstrated to produce endorphins, the body’s natural feel-good chemicals. Mitchell says, “it’s about mental clarity and stress release, not only about your body.”

4. Works on Your Core and Legs Especially in your legs, glues, and core, cycling is excellent for increasing muscle strength. This facilitates better general physical performance and stability.

5. Boosts endurance. Mitchell says, “regular cycling helps build stamina and endurance, so facilitating the performance of other daily activities.”

6. Managing Weight Without overly taxing your body, cycling can help you burn calories and keep a good weight. It’s also a great, interesting approach to keep moving.

Therefore, riding in your living room or on the open road provides several advantages for your body and mind.
